The purpose of this study is to evaluate the safety and efficacy of a continuous hepatic arterial infusion combination therapy with OPC-18 and 5-FU versus BST in patients with highly advanced hepatocellular carcinoma for which resection therapy or local therapy is inapplicable due to advanced vascular invasion.
